London Southend Airport Company Limited is hiring a Passenger Experience Assistant to ensure exemplary service for passengers. You will handle check-ins, assist with boarding, and support those needing help, all while embodying the Airport's culture.

This role offers a pay rate of £13.10 per hour and a wealth of benefits including health coverage, wellbeing apps, and training opportunities.

The ideal candidate should have strong communication skills and prior customer service experience.

How to prepare for a job interview at London Southend Airport Company Limited.

Show Off Your People Skills

In customer support, it's all about communicating effectively. Prepare to share instances from your past experiences where you handled difficult customers or resolved conflicts. We want to hear how you empathised and found the best solutions, so think of specific examples to back up your stories!

Know the Tools of the Trade

Familiarise yourself with common customer support tools like Zendesk or Freshdesk, and make sure to review how you’ve used any similar systems in the past. During the interview, being able to discuss your hands-on experience with software or ticketing systems can really set you apart from the competition, so don’t skip this prep!

Show Genuine Enthusiasm

As this is a full-time role, employers want someone who isn’t just looking for any job, but wants to grow within customer support. Make sure to express your enthusiasm for helping customers and your desire to develop your skills. Show them why you're passionate about this field!

Practice Common Scenarios

Be prepared for role-playing scenarios where you might have to reassess a solution with a frustrated customer or explain a complex process in simple terms. Practising these common scenarios can help us feel more confident and demonstrate our practical skills effectively during the interview.
